Carrier Global Corporation is an American multinational home appliances corporation based in Palm Beach Gardens, Florida. Carrier was founded in 1915 as an independent company manufacturing and distributing heating, ventilating and air conditioning (HVAC) systems, and has since expanded to include manufacturing commercial refrigeration and foodservice equipment, and fire and security technologies.
As of 2020, it was an $18.6 billion company with over 53,000 employees serving customers in 160 countries on six continents.
Carrier was acquired by United Technologies in 1979, but it was spun off as an independent company 41 years later in 2020, as was the Otis Elevator Company.
